Dec. 9th: Once a Week!

Alright - so tonight I went to support a good friend in Gateway Theatre's production of The Sound of Music.  Because this was yet another day of me going to see a theatre show, I had to look into my calendar this past year to figure out how many shows I have seen in 2011.  I know that my calendar did not include every single show I went to see but I don't think I've missed too many.  Based on numbers, i t turns out that I have kept an average of seeing about one show a week this past year.  That's including some of the shows that I was in and/or involved with (including some improv shows), but it does not include the times that I went to see shows more than once (and there are a number of those).

I'm pretty proud of the one show a week.  I'm glad to know that I have made a good effort this year to make theatre a priority in my life, while still making room for my other passions (ie. choir, concerts, trips to the island and back home, etc.).  Here's the list of all of the theatre/improv/dance shows I saw this year - as far as my schedule is concerned.  Anything italicized were the shows that I was involved with and therefore may have attended more than once.
